Agnes Grey by Anne Brontë is a quietly powerful portrayal of resilience, morality, and dignity in the face of social inequality. Through the eyes of Agnes, a governess from a modest background, the novel explores the realities of class, gender, and emotional endurance within the rigid hierarchy of Victorian society.
As Agnes takes on her role within the homes of the wealthy, she confronts not only unruly children and indifferent employers, but also the deep-seated prejudices and injustices of the time. Brontë’s prose is marked by subtle wit, empathetic insight, and moral clarity, making this work a profound reflection on the limited agency of women and the quiet strength it takes to remain true to one’s principles.
